Common Wood Floor Replacement Jobs
Complete wood floor replacement - involves removing existing flooring and installing new hardwood surfaces.
Partial wood floor replacement - replaces damaged or worn sections to match existing flooring.
Engineered wood flooring replacement - updates or repairs engineered wood surfaces for durability and style.
Subfloor repair and replacement - ensures a solid foundation before installing new wood flooring.
Refinishing and sanding services - restores the appearance of existing wood floors to like-new condition.
Custom wood flooring installation - adds unique patterns or finishes to enhance property aesthetics.
Wood Floor Replacement Questions
What types of wood floors can be replaced? Various wood flooring types, including hardwood, engineered wood, and laminate, can be replaced or refinished to match existing styles.
When should a wood floor be replaced instead of repaired? Replacement is recommended when the flooring is severely damaged, warped, or has extensive wear that cannot be restored through refinishing.
What are common signs that indicate a wood floor needs replacement? Visible deep scratches, large areas of cupping or buckling, and persistent stains are signs that replacement may be necessary.
What should property owners consider before replacing a wood floor? Consider the existing floor’s condition, the desired appearance, and compatibility with the surrounding space to ensure a seamless update.
